Implement Exclusion Steps



Evaluating and sealing access points is the initial step in rodent-proofing your outdoor space; now you'll take action by carrying out exclusion actions.

Beginning by installing door brushes up on all exterior doors to stop rodents from pressing with voids. Seal cracks and holes with weather-resistant sealer, concentrating on locations where energy pipelines enter your home.

Usage wire mesh to cover vents and chimneys, guaranteeing they're securely attached. Trim tree branches and greenery away from your house to get rid of possible bridges for rodents to access your roofing.

In addition, take into consideration setting up steel blinking around the base of your home to avoid burrowing. Shop firewood a minimum of 18 inches off the ground and far from your home.

Maintain rubbish in snugly secured containers, and quickly clean up any type of spilled birdseed or pet food. By implementing these exclusion steps, you can considerably lower the chance of rats invading your exterior room.

Maintain Tidiness and Trimmed Landscape Design



Ensure your outdoor room stays neat and your landscape design is regularly cut to prevent rodents from finding harborage or food resources. Maintaining your yard clean is vital to lessening destinations for rats. Eliminate any kind of debris, mess, or extra things that can act as hiding places for these pests. Rats are attracted to areas with simple accessibility to food and shelter, so by preserving cleanliness, you make your building less enticing to them.

Frequently trimming your landscaping is additionally critical in rodent-proofing your outside space. Disordered plants offers rodents with ample hiding areas and potential nesting websites. By maintaining your grass cut, shrubs cut, and trees trimmed, you remove prospective habitats for rats. Additionally, trimmed landscape design makes it harder for rats to access your home as they choose areas with enough coverage for protection.
